A podcast hosted by the Florida Panthers’ play-by-play voice and nationally-recognized radio/TV broadcaster Steve Goldstein. Laser-focused on bringing you the latest in the world of hockey and all-things Panthers. In-depth, insightful conversations with players, staff, and media members around the NHL.

Episode 17: Scotty Bowman
Monday May 27, 2019
Monday May 27, 2019
Host Steve Goldstein sits down with legendary head coach - and current Senior Advisor of Hockey Operations for the Chicago Blackhawks - Scotty Bowman.
Bowman relives his coaching days in vivid detail and gives his thoughts on the upcoming Stanley Cup Finals, which will feature the Boston Bruins and the St. Louis Blues.

Episode 16: Joel Quenneville
Monday Apr 08, 2019
Monday Apr 08, 2019
In this episode, Steve Goldstein sits down with the Panthers' new head coach and 3-time Stanley Cup champion Joel Quenneville.
Quenneville talks about what brought him to the Panthers, his relationship with Dale Tallon, and his initial impressions of the team with the off-season already underway.
